Easy Valentine’s Day Activities
- What I Love About… : Valentine’s Day is a holiday to celebrate love.
So, this activity helps kids think about all the things they love! This FREE worksheet has kids write or draw what they love about school, family, friends, themselves, and more. A wonderful way to celebrate the day of love!
- Gratitude Activity Pack: Valentine’s Day is the perfect time to have kids reflect on what they are thankful for. These printables are an easy way to do that! The pack includes a gratitude journal, gratitude letter writing paper, and gratitude writing prompts. Another option is to discuss gratitude with your kids, or just have them write about what they are thankful for.
- Valentine’s Day Memory Book : If your kids have already done some exciting Valentine’s Day activities, creating a memory book is a great closing activity (or next day activity). It encourages kids to reflect on their day through writing and/or drawing, which will help them process and remember their Valentine’s Day. Plus, it makes for a great keepsake!
- Making Valentines: Making cards is an oldie, but a goodie. Have your kids think about
someone they care about, then make a valentine for that person. Next, get out construction paper, markers, crayons, paint, stickers, foam shapes, pipe cleaners, doilies, or whatever craft supplies you have. Your kids will have fun using their creativity and expressing their love for important people in their lives!
